Mcnair Lake Dam

Mcnair Lake Dam is an earth dam located in Clay County, Georgia.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.

About Mcnair Lake Dam

The primary purpose of Mcnair Lake Dam is recreation. The dam creates a reservoir used for recreational activities such as fishing, boating, and swimming. The dam is owned by Mcnair, Lester (private). It impounds the Unknown near Bluffton.

The dam stands 18 feet tall and stretches 105 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 4 acres, and has a maximum storage capacity of 52 acre-feet.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life. The most recent inspection on record was 10/09/2009. That was over 16 years ago.
